Abstract

The interface agent is a computer program that employs
machine-learning techniques to assist a user in dealing with a particular application by using a
computer, learning new ”short cut” methods and suggesting a better ways for doing the user tasks.
End- user programming and /or knowledge engineering for knowledge acquisition are used to learn
interface agent but these learning systems require a large amount of work from the knowledge
engineer. Furthermore, the knowledge of the agent is fixed and cannot be customized to the habits
of individual users.
This work presents a framework of multi-agent system, which consists of adaptive interface agent,
feature extraction and set of agents trained by using neural network that collaborates with
adaptive interface agent to detect the femur fractures in x-ray images automatically? Then, the
proposed system decreases the workload of radiologist and improves the accuracy of diagnose their.
The adaptive interface agent provides a semi-intelligent system learnt by the ”Customizer Dialog”
from the user’s interests, goals and general preferences. A major problem with the learning
